Egan's Final Exam 2023 with complete solution;Actual Questions and Answers 
 
What is the primary indication for tracheal suctioning? 
Retention of secretions 
What is the most common complication of suctioning? 
hypoxemia. 
Complications of tracheal suctioning include all of the following except: 
hyperinflation 
How often should patients be suctioned? 
When physical findings support the need 
What is the normal range of negative pressure to use when suctioning an adult patient?
